Output 8ec23dbefad93f6e6baf39b70a4b2a7f6f889d5b9089729a88c3c45b304087f5:0

value
1269063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6698a9be09e2ade2167a386eac6af3d0fa54041e OP_EQUAL
address
3B3VjKqPQudrQLbKoNRrefbDZMtqbi4HiH
transaction
8ec23dbefad93f6e6baf39b70a4b2a7f6f889d5b9089729a88c3c45b304087f5
spent
true